随笔分类 -  Oracle

1 2 下一页

探秘MySQL三个神秘隐藏列(mysql三个隐藏列) rownum、rowid、oid
摘要:探秘MySQL三个神秘隐藏列 MySQL是一款流行的关系型数据库管理系统,被广泛应用于Web应用程序开发和数据存储。然而,MySQL也有一些神秘的隐藏列,这些隐藏列可以帮助我们更好地管理和查询数据。 接下来,我们将探秘MySQL三个神秘隐藏列:ROWNUM、ROWID和OID。 ROWNUM 在Or 阅读全文

posted @ 2023-09-05 09:37 小石头小祖宗 阅读(762) 评论(0) 推荐(0) 编辑

role、user、schema在Oracle、MySQL、PostgreSQL的区别
摘要:0.先上结论 数据库逻辑可以细分为:角色、用户、数据库、模式PostgreSQL和MySQL合并了角色和用户,MySQL还合并了数据库、模式Oracle合并了用户、数据库、模式 1.图 1.1.架构 1.2.用户和角色 1.2.1.PostgreSQL 1.2.2.MySQL 1.2.3.Oracl 阅读全文

posted @ 2023-09-03 23:39 小石头小祖宗 阅读(84) 评论(0) 推荐(0) 编辑

sql中union all、union、intersect、minus的区别图解,测试
摘要:相关文章 sql 的 join、left join、full join的区别图解总结,测试,注意事项 1.结论示意图 对于intersect、minus,oracle支持,mysql不支持,可以变通(in或exists)实现 2.创建表和数据 -- 建表 drop table if exists s 阅读全文

posted @ 2023-08-13 21:45 小石头小祖宗 阅读(61) 评论(0) 推荐(0) 编辑

mysql explain详解,type性能排名system>const>eq_ref>ref>fulltext>range>index>ALL,索引失效情况总结(未完)
摘要:1.explain说明 序号列名描述1id在一个大的查询语句中每个SELECT关键字都对应一个 唯一的id2select_typeSELECT关键字对应的那个查询的类型3table表名4partitions匹配的分区信息5type ★针对单表的访问方法6possible_keys可能用到的索引7ke 阅读全文

posted @ 2023-08-12 23:52 小石头小祖宗 阅读(989) 评论(0) 推荐(3) 编辑

sql中null值。只有`is null`能查到`null`值记录。`null`既不属于`是`也不属于`非`(即`score = ‘1‘`与`score != ‘1‘`均查不到`null`记录)
摘要:1.先上结论 只有is null能查到null值记录。null既不属于是也不属于非(即score = '1'与score != '1'均查不到null记录),同理以下均查不到null值。 序号条件1=、!=、<>2>、<、>、>=、<=3in、not in4like、not like5between 阅读全文

posted @ 2023-08-11 21:27 小石头小祖宗 阅读(8) 评论(0) 推荐(0) 编辑

Oracle、JDK、ojdbc驱动版本的对应关系。官网下载地址
摘要:Oracle Database Version Release-Specific JDBC JAR File with Supported JDK 21.x ojdbc11.jar with JDK 11, JDK 12, JDK 13, JDK 14 and JDK 15 ojdbc8.jar w 阅读全文

posted @ 2023-02-04 17:00 小石头小祖宗 阅读(523) 评论(0) 推荐(0) 编辑

数据库事务的ACID特性:原子性、一致性、隔离性、持久性详解,数据库事务隔离级别详解
摘要:目录 总结表 what-事务定义 why-为什么需要事务,事务的必要性 what-数据库事务ACID特性 原子性(atomicity) 一致性(consistency) 隔离性(isolation)——指不同事务之间 持久性(durability) A(Atomicity),原子性。 C(consi 阅读全文

posted @ 2020-09-05 21:29 小石头小祖宗 阅读(135) 评论(0) 推荐(0) 编辑

sql92和SQL99的区别
摘要:SQL92和SQL99都是用来表示多表的联合查询使用的,两者在开发中,具体使用哪一种都是可以的,但是在书写和阅读的过程中,具体表现在以下: 1、笛卡尔积中的区别 ①SQL92中的笛卡尔积:select * from emp,dept ②SQL99中的笛卡尔积:select * from emp cr 阅读全文

posted @ 2020-09-05 19:24 小石头小祖宗 阅读(62) 评论(0) 推荐(0) 编辑

oracle 11g 完全卸载
摘要:目录 1、停用oracle服务 2、在开始菜单中,找到Universal Installer,运行Oracle Universal Installer,单击卸载产品 3、在产品清单窗口中,单击全部展开,除了OraDb11g_home1外,勾选其他项目,单击删除 4、按Windows徽标键和R键,打开 阅读全文

posted @ 2020-03-31 17:19 小石头小祖宗 阅读(15) 评论(0) 推荐(0) 编辑

create table like、create table select、insert into select的区别对比。sql(mysql、oracle等)复制表结构、表数据、索引。
摘要:1.结论 1.1.语法 -- 1.创建表不复制数据(含表结构和索引、自增等约束)。不支持oracle。 create table {table_new} like {table_old}; -- 2.不建表只复制数据(数据来自select。select很灵活,可以select任意字段,可以连表) i 阅读全文

posted @ 2019-11-05 17:13 小石头小祖宗 阅读(40) 评论(0) 推荐(0) 编辑

Oracle中alter system命令参数之scope
摘要:SCOPE The SCOPE clause lets you specify when the change takes effect. Scope depends on whether you started up the database using a client-side paramet 阅读全文

posted @ 2019-10-29 15:13 小石头小祖宗 阅读(21) 评论(0) 推荐(0) 编辑

oracle数据库赋予一个用户查询另一个用户中所有表
摘要:说明:让用户selame能够查询用户ame中的所有表(不能添加和删除) 1.创建用户selame create user selame identified by Password; 2.设置用户selame系统权限 grant connect,resource to selame; 3.设置用户s 阅读全文

posted @ 2019-09-09 18:18 小石头小祖宗 阅读(22) 评论(0) 推荐(0) 编辑

oracle 查看表占用空间大小
摘要:查看当前用户 select SEGMENT_NAME as TABLE_NAME,BYTES/1024/1024 as 大小MB from USER_SEGMENTS where SEGMENT_TYPE='TABLE' order by BYTES desc; select * from USER 阅读全文

posted @ 2019-08-28 14:53 小石头小祖宗 阅读(4) 评论(0) 推荐(0) 编辑

oracle VARCHAR VARCHAR2 NVARCHAR2的区别
摘要:区别: VARCHAR(size type),size最大为4000,type可以是char也可以是byte,默认是byte(如:name VARCHAR2(60)),符合工业标准,可以存储空字符串。 VARCHAR2(size type),size最大为4000,type可以是char也可以是by 阅读全文

posted @ 2019-08-28 14:42 小石头小祖宗 阅读(46) 评论(0) 推荐(0) 编辑

oracle “日期date”与“字符串”相互转换 TO_DATE ,TO_CHAR
摘要:select TO_DATE('2019-07-23 14:31:23', 'SYYYY-MM-DD HH24:MI:SS') from dual; select TO_CHAR(SYSDATE, 'SYYYY-MM-DD HH24:MI:SS') from dual; syyyy-mm-dd hh 阅读全文

posted @ 2019-08-08 11:33 小石头小祖宗 阅读(14) 评论(0) 推荐(0) 编辑

oracle11g 使用数据泵导入/导出数据(expdp/impdp)
摘要:目标:使用oracle数据泵,将A电脑上的数据库databaseA导出后,再导入到B电脑上的数据库databaseB中。 A电脑上的操作(expdp数据导出): 运行cmd; 登录数据库,输入命令:sqlplus; 使用管理员角色登录需要在用户名后加“ as sysdba” 例如:sys as sy 阅读全文

posted @ 2019-07-09 15:54 小石头小祖宗 阅读(294) 评论(0) 推荐(0) 编辑

oracle查询执行sql历史
摘要:select t.first_load_time,t.last_load_time,t.LAST_ACTIVE_TIME,t.* from v$sqlarea t order by t.LAST_ACTIVE_TIME desc; 阅读全文

posted @ 2019-04-29 14:55 小石头小祖宗 阅读(19) 评论(0) 推荐(0) 编辑

11g参数之deferred_segment_creation,解决exp不能导出空表问题
摘要:介绍 deferred_segment_creation,布尔型 ,默认值为true 这个参数10gR2中是没有的,11g中才有 从字面意思也可以看出来,当这个参数设置为true时,当创建一个表的时候,不给它分配segment,即不分配空间,当向这个表中插入第一条数据的时候才开始分配segment。 阅读全文

posted @ 2019-04-13 23:33 小石头小祖宗 阅读(9) 评论(0) 推荐(0) 编辑

oracle查看所有对象(表、视图、索引、函数、存储过程等)的详细参数和注释,DDL定义语句
摘要:目录 1.总结 1.1.查看所有对象的详细信息和注释(表、视图、函数等) 1.2.查看所有对象DDL定义语句(表、视图、函数等) 2.测试 2.1.查看所有对象的详细信息和注释(表、视图、函数等) 2.1.1.表、视图、字段的详细参数 2.1.2.表、视图、字段的注释说明 2.1.3.函数、存储过程 阅读全文

posted @ 2019-04-13 22:46 小石头小祖宗 阅读(161) 评论(0) 推荐(0) 编辑

EXP-00091: 正在导出有问题的统计信息
摘要:1、查看服务器编码 select * from nls_database_parameters t where t.parameter='NLS_CHARACTERSET'; select * from v$nls_parameters where parameter='NLS_CHARACTERS 阅读全文

posted @ 2019-03-14 15:03 小石头小祖宗 阅读(109) 评论(0) 推荐(0) 编辑

1 2 下一页
< 2025年2月 >
26 27 28 29 30 31 1
2 3 4 5 6 7 8
9 10 11 12 13 14 15
16 17 18 19 20 21 22
23 24 25 26 27 28 1
2 3 4 5 6 7 8

导航

统计

点击右上角即可分享
微信分享提示